Skimmia reevesiana

Skimmia reevesiana is a broad-leaved evergreen that thrives in shaded areas, making it ideal for woodland gardens. It is notable for producing red berries without the need for a pollinator, alongside fragrant white flowers. The plant has a compact, well-branched form with lance-shaped dark-green foliage that is resistant to deer. It prefers rich, moist, well-drained soil, adding a touch of elegance to shaded garden spaces. This plant is perfect for those looking to add year-round interest with minimal maintenance.
